@import"https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700&family=Outfit:wght@400;500;600;700;800&display=swap";:root{--bg-main: #FFFFFF;--bg-sub: #F8FAFC;--primary: #0F172A;--accent: #06B6D4;--accent-soft: rgba(6, 182, 212, .08);--text-main: #334155;--text-dim: #64748B;--border: #E2E8F0;--success: #10B981;--white: #FFFFFF}*{margin:0;padding:0;box-sizing:border-box}body{font-family:Inter,sans-serif;background-color:var(--bg-main);color:var(--text-main);line-height:1.6;overflow-x:hidden}h1,h2,h3,h4,h5,h6{font-family:Outfit,sans-serif;font-weight:700;color:var(--primary);letter-spacing:-.02em}.container{max-width:1200px;margin:0 auto;padding:0 2rem}.section-sterile{background:var(--bg-sub);border-top:1px solid var(--border);border-bottom:1px solid var(--border)}.card-lab{background:var(--white);border:1px solid var(--border);border-radius:12px;padding:2.5rem;transition:all .4s cubic-bezier(.4,0,.2,1);box-shadow:0 4px 6px -1px #0000000d}.card-lab:hover{border-color:var(--accent);box-shadow:0 20px 25px -5px #0000001a;transform:translateY(-4px)}.btn-scientific{background:var(--primary);color:var(--white);padding:1rem 2.5rem;border-radius:6px;font-family:Outfit,sans-serif;font-weight:600;cursor:pointer;transition:all .3s ease;text-decoration:none;display:inline-block;border:none}.btn-scientific:hover{background:var(--accent);box-shadow:0 10px 15px -3px #06b6d440}.btn-outline{background:transparent;color:var(--primary);border:2px solid var(--primary);padding:.9rem 2.5rem;border-radius:6px;font-family:Outfit,sans-serif;font-weight:600;cursor:pointer;transition:all .3s ease;text-decoration:none;display:inline-block}.btn-outline:hover{background:var(--bg-sub);border-color:var(--accent);color:var(--accent)}.text-cyan{color:var(--accent)}section{padding:100px 0}.badge-qc{background:var(--accent-soft);color:var(--accent);padding:.5rem 1.2rem;border-radius:99px;font-size:.85rem;font-weight:600;text-transform:uppercase;letter-spacing:.05em;display:inline-flex;align-items:center;gap:.5rem;margin-bottom:1.5rem}.manufacturing-hero{background:linear-gradient(135deg,#f8fafc,#eff6ff);position:relative;overflow:hidden}.manufacturing-hero:before{content:"";position:absolute;top:0;right:0;width:40%;height:100%;background:radial-gradient(circle at 70% 30%,rgba(6,182,212,.05) 0%,transparent 70%);pointer-events:none}.nav-sticky{position:sticky;top:0;background:#ffffffe6;-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);border-bottom:1px solid var(--border);z-index:1000}.sticky-contact-wrapper{position:fixed;bottom:2rem;right:2rem;display:flex;flex-direction:column;gap:1rem;z-index:2000}.sticky-btn{width:60px;height:60px;border-radius:50%;display:flex;align-items:center;justify-content:center;box-shadow:0 10px 25px #00000026;transition:all .3s cubic-bezier(.175,.885,.32,1.275);cursor:pointer;border:none;text-decoration:none}.sticky-btn:hover{transform:scale(1.1) rotate(5deg)}.whatsapp-btn{background:#25d366;color:#fff}.telegram-btn{background:#08c;color:#fff}.nav-container{display:flex;justify-content:space-between;align-items:center;height:80px;position:relative}.nav-logo{height:40px;width:auto}.nav-links{display:flex;gap:2.5rem;align-items:center}.nav-links a{color:#64748b;text-decoration:none;font-weight:500}.hamburger-btn{display:none;background:none;border:none;cursor:pointer;color:var(--primary)}.hero-grid{display:grid;grid-template-columns:1.2fr .8fr;gap:4rem;align-items:center}.hero-title{font-size:4.5rem;line-height:1.1;margin-bottom:2rem}.hero-text{font-size:1.25rem;color:#64748b;margin-bottom:3rem;max-width:600px}.hero-actions{display:flex;gap:1.5rem}.about-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:2.5rem}.mfg-grid{display:grid;grid-template-columns:1fr 1fr;gap:5rem;align-items:center}.mfg-item-icon{flex-shrink:0;width:56px;height:56px;background:var(--accent-soft);border-radius:12px;display:flex;align-items:center;justify-content:center}.mfg-item-flex{display:flex;gap:1.5rem}.mfg-box{background:#f1f5f9;border-radius:24px;padding:3rem}.tour-grid{display:grid;grid-template-columns:repeat(4,1fr);gap:1.5rem}.docs-flex{display:flex;justify-content:space-between;align-items:center;gap:2rem}.docs-actions{display:flex;gap:1rem}.services-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:2rem}.contact-grid{display:grid;grid-template-columns:1fr 1fr;gap:4rem}.contact-form-grid{display:grid;grid-template-columns:1fr 1fr;gap:1rem}.contact-form-box{background:#fff;border:1px solid #E2E8F0;padding:3rem;border-radius:24px;box-shadow:0 10px 30px #0000000d}.footer-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:4rem;margin-bottom:4rem}.contact-info-flex{display:flex;flex-direction:column;gap:2.5rem}img{max-width:100%}@media (max-width: 1024px){.container{padding:0 1.5rem}.hero-title{font-size:3.5rem}.mfg-grid,.contact-grid{gap:3rem}.hero-grid{gap:2rem}section{padding:80px 0}}@media (max-width: 768px){.nav-links{display:none;position:absolute;top:80px;left:0;right:0;background:#fffffffa;flex-direction:column;padding:2rem;gap:1.5rem;box-shadow:0 10px 15px -3px #0000001a;border-bottom:1px solid var(--border);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px)}.nav-links.active{display:flex}.hamburger-btn{display:block}.hero-grid,.mfg-grid,.docs-flex,.contact-grid{grid-template-columns:1fr}.docs-flex{flex-direction:column;align-items:flex-start}.docs-actions{flex-direction:column;width:100%}.docs-actions button{width:100%;margin-bottom:.5rem}.about-grid,.tour-grid{grid-template-columns:repeat(2,1fr)}.hero-actions{flex-direction:column}.hero-actions a{width:100%;text-align:center;justify-content:center}.hero-title{font-size:2.5rem}.contact-form-grid{grid-template-columns:1fr}.mfg-box,.contact-form-box{padding:2rem}.manufacturing-hero{padding:80px 0}}@media (max-width: 480px){.about-grid,.tour-grid{grid-template-columns:1fr}section{padding:60px 0}.hero-title{font-size:2.2rem}.badge-qc{font-size:.75rem}.manufacturing-hero{padding:60px 0}}
